Understanding the Science of Waterproof Makeup

Before diving into the methods of making your foundation waterproof, it's essential to understand what makes a product waterproof. Waterproof makeup is typically formulated with specific ingredients that repel water and sweat. These can include silicone-based compounds, waxes, and oils that create a barrier on the skin. Regular foundations, on the other hand, may lack these properties, making them susceptible to smudging and fading when exposed to moisture.

Step-by-Step Guide to Waterproofing Your Foundation

  1. Prep Your Skin Properly

The first step in ensuring your foundation remains waterproof is to prepare your skin adequately. Start with a clean, moisturized face. Use a lightweight, oil-free moisturizer to avoid excess shine. Follow this with a mattifying primer, which not only helps to control oil but also creates a smooth canvas for your foundation. Look for primers that contain silicone, as they can enhance the waterproof effect.

  1. Choose the Right Foundation

While you may want to use your favorite regular foundation, consider opting for a long-wear or semi-matte formula that has better staying power. If you’re determined to use your existing foundation, mix it with a waterproof mixing medium. These products are designed to transform any liquid makeup into a waterproof version, allowing you to maintain your preferred look without compromising on durability.

  1. Application Techniques Matter

How you apply your foundation can significantly impact its longevity. Use a damp makeup sponge or a foundation brush to apply your foundation evenly. A damp sponge helps to press the product into the skin, creating a more seamless finish. For added coverage and durability, consider using a stippling motion rather than sweeping it across the skin.

  1. Set with Powder

After applying your foundation, it’s crucial to set it with a translucent setting powder. This step helps to absorb excess moisture and oil, locking your foundation in place. For an extra layer of waterproofing, opt for a waterproof setting powder. Apply it lightly with a fluffy brush, focusing on areas prone to shine, such as the T-zone.

  1. Seal with a Setting Spray

To further enhance the waterproof quality of your makeup, finish with a setting spray. Look for a setting spray specifically labeled as waterproof or long-lasting. Hold the spray about 8-10 inches away from your face and mist it evenly over your makeup. This final step creates a protective barrier that helps to keep your foundation intact, even in challenging conditions.

Additional Tips for Waterproofing Your Makeup

  • Blotting Papers: Keep blotting papers handy to absorb excess oil throughout the day without disturbing your makeup.
  • Avoid Touching Your Face: This may seem simple, but touching your face can transfer oils and moisture, breaking down your foundation.
  • Choose Waterproof Products for Other Makeup: If you’re going for a waterproof look, consider using waterproof eyeliners, mascaras, and brow products to complement your foundation.
